Prospective Limited Accessibility Issues

Oem Construction PartsOem Construction Parts
Availability Difficulties Presented by Limited Stock of OEM Building Components can Influence Devices Maintenance and Fixing Schedules.

When counting on OEM building parts for devices repair and maintenance, one significant drawback that can emerge is the prospective restricted availability of these components. Because of elements such as production schedules, supply chain disturbances, or the discontinuation of specific components by suppliers, there might be instances where OEM parts come to be scarce or perhaps obsolete. This deficiency can result in delays in equipment maintenance, long term downtime, and increased expenses related to sourcing alternative services.

Minimal accessibility of OEM construction components can likewise hamper the effectiveness of upkeep teams, as they might require to spend additional time and initiative browsing for ideal replacements or awaiting back-ordered parts to get here. In situations where details OEM parts are crucial for ideal equipment efficiency or safety compliance, the absence of these components can posture major functional risks. To alleviate these challenges, equipment supervisors ought to maintain clear interaction with vendors, discover choices for equipping important parts in breakthrough, and consider alternate remedies or aftermarket components when OEM choices are limited.
